Output 66e23fe7d8b44969e674eb73ff1aa3d0989b18f6b39bb28653d27bd4580dd1d7:9

value
250959545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fc6a75cbf6ced0272fce7ae168c2d880af9a005 OP_EQUAL
address
3KB2xtVDYrb2eiNE7Z8n8BAC9cG3TZzEzp
transaction
66e23fe7d8b44969e674eb73ff1aa3d0989b18f6b39bb28653d27bd4580dd1d7
spent
true